Intel Core i5-12600K vs AMD Ryzen 7 5800X3D
The Intel Core i5-12600K and AMD Ryzen 7 5800X3D sit within a few percent of each other on our index. Treat them as equivalent in raw performance and decide on price, power draw and — for graphics cards — video memory instead.
| Specification | Intel Core i5-12600K | AMD Ryzen 7 5800X3D |
|---|---|---|
| Manufacturer | Intel | AMD |
| Generation | 12th Gen (Alder Lake) | Zen 3 |
| Multi-thread index | 140 (better) | 135 |
| Single-thread index | 112 (better) | 104 |
| Cores | 10 (better) | 8 |
| Threads | 16 | 16 |
| Base clock | 3.7 GHz (better) | 3.4 GHz |
| Boost clock | 4.9 GHz (better) | 4.5 GHz |
| Socket | LGA1700 | AM4 |
| TDP | 125 W | 105 W (better) |
| Release year | 2021 | 2022 (better) |
| Integrated graphics | Yes | No |

Which should you pick?
- Games follow single-thread. For gaming, the single-thread index matters more than core count.
- Creative work follows multi-thread. Rendering, compiling and encoding scale with cores.
- Sockets differ. Moving between platforms usually means a new motherboard and often new memory.
